Fan Focus: What can Sunderland expect from David Moyes’ Everton side?

The easiest way to look at it, is who has made the biggest impact, and that is Kiernan Dewsbury-Hall. He’s been a regular starter, a key component of the three players who play behind the striker and someone the manager clearly trusts. It’s proved to be much more difficult for the the other three.

The lack of game time for Alcaraz has come as somewhat of a surprise, especially given how well he did during his loan spell last season. When he has come off the bench, he’s tended to make a bit of a difference as well, so it’s a bit of a puzzle.

Both Dibling and Barry are yet to impress, but there has to be caveats as to why. It’s clear that the manager wants to give Dibling time to settle and learn from those around him, but given the size of his transfer fee, fans automatically expect him to feature more and more from him. We’ve seen glimpses of what he is capable of, but it’s early days yet and judgement of him wouldn’t be warranted.

Thierno Barry is the one new permanent signing that fans have been most vocal about. Decent money was paid for him, so like with Dibling, instant success is expected. Both him and Beto have been given numerous opportunities to cement the starting striker position for themselves, with neither eager to do so. He’s a young lad and patience is needed. He certainly looked brighter when he came off the bench against Spurs. Once he gets his first goal, we hope the floodgates open for him.
